The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the Uttlesford local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three CLACHAN BRAE sales between October 2000 and October 2016 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the April 2012 sale was for 21%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 21% above the HPI over time, until the October 2016 sale, where it falls to 10%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 10% above the HPI.

CLACHAN BRAE sits on a plot of roughly 0.068 of an acre, or 275m². The below map shows the location of CLACHAN BRAE, an approximate outline of the building(s), and the indicative extent of the property. The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of CLACHAN BRAE).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
